Rockets Stats
- Houston outscores opponents by 5.3 points per game (scoring 114.7 per game to rank 20th in the league while allowing 109.4 per contest to rank third in the NBA) and has a +319 scoring differential overall.
- The Rockets' leading scorer, Kevin Durant, ranks 10th in the NBA scoring 26.3 points per game.
- Houston wins the rebound battle by 8.8 boards on average. It collects 48.4 rebounds per game, which ranks first in the league, while its opponents grab 39.6 per outing.
- Alperen Sengun's 9.2 rebounds per game lead the Rockets and rank 11th in league play.
- Houston connects on 11.4 three-pointers per game (26th in the league) compared to its opponents' 12.2. It shoots 36.9% from deep while its opponents hit 34.8% from long range.
- Reed Sheppard is 25th in the NBA and leads the Rockets with 2.6 made treys per game.

Warriors Stats
- Golden State is outscoring opponents by 1.2 points per game, with a +77 scoring differential overall. It puts up 115.3 points per game (16th in NBA) and allows 114.1 per outing (11th in league).
- Brandin Podziemski paces the Warriors, putting up 12.4 points per game (100th in league).
- The 42.8 rebounds per game Golden State accumulates rank 23rd in the NBA, 2.2 fewer than the 45 its opponents record.
- Podziemski tops the Warriors with 5.1 rebounds per game (81st in league).
- Golden State knocks down 16.3 three-pointers per game (first in the league) at a 36% rate (14th in NBA), compared to the 12.6 per game its opponents make, at a 35.3% rate.
- The Warriors are paced by Podziemski's 1.7 threes per game (84th in league).
